Cryptocurrency Boom In Online Gambling

Online casinos and the gambling industry alone have been experiencing a boom for years. Hundreds of billions are turned over worldwide in the gambling industry. Cryptocurrencies account for an ever-increasing share of this.

Why are cryptocurrencies so popular with casino goers?

Everyone will probably have heard of Bitcoin or Litecoin by now. In 2009 Bitcoin saw the light of day and could be purchased for a few dollars. A new technology was born that wants to be seen as an alternative to regular currencies under state control.

The blockchain is the basis of digital currencies. This enables particularly fast transactions that work across countries, without exchange rates and similar obstacles. All transactions are linked together like in a chain. A transaction that has been carried out can no longer be manipulated afterward. An absolutely safe system so far.

Another point that benefits many casino visitors is the enormous security of personal data. If you play with cryptocurrencies in an online major playground (메이저놀이터) casino, you only have to enter your crypto wallet email address and possibly your personal pin to authorize transactions. Account details and other sensitive information are no longer necessary.

How are providers reacting to this trend?

The casino industry has become a highly competitive market. Every year, if not monthly, new digital game portals open their doors. In order to stand out from the crowd and stay in the players’ field of vision, the providers must always be up to date in terms of software and payment methods. The IT and software industry is evolving at a breakneck pace.

An example of this is the cryptocurrencies that seem to finally conquer the casino market. More and more consumers are familiar with digital coins and many use them to trade, but also to buy online services.

Cryptocurrency as a secure payment method

Bitcoin, as the mother of all digital currencies, naturally still has the largest trading volume on the market and is therefore particularly popular as a payment option in online casinos. However, there are also strong coins such as Litecoin, Ethereum, or Dogecoin, which many platforms offer as an alternative to Bitcoin.

Cryptocurrency and Online Gambling License

A gambling license functions as proof or evidence that the business is legitimate which allows the owner to set up an account from the bank allowing it to process wire transfers as well as credit card payments. With the blockchain technology, banks that act as middlemen become unnecessary since the network is a system that is self-governed. This would then mean that online gambling facilities could function even without a gambling license insofar as they are adapted or tailored to work with payments or transactions done through the blockchain.

This doesn’t sound so bad since such transactions over the blockchain network are almost instant as well as safe as they are secured by really strong encryption. Thus, it develops into a matter of individual choice or preference if you would choose to transact with a gambling operator that don’t have a license or a license and reputable gambling operator, where there are several of both types of operators that accept cryptocurrencies.
